What Makes a Gambling Website Reliable?
Trustworthiness is arguably the most critical factor when choosing a gambling website. Licensing from reputable authorities ensures a certain level of oversight and fairness in gameplay. For example, regulators like the UK Gambling Commission and Malta Gaming Authority enforce strict rules that protect players. Equally important is the presence of secure payment methods. Many sites now accept widely used options such as Visa, Mastercard, and e-wallets, alongside newer technologies like Vipps in certain regions.
Moreover, many platforms offer detailed information on return-to-player (RTP) rates—where, say, a slot like Starburst might boast an RTP of about 96%. Knowing these figures can guide players toward games that statistically offer better odds over time. It’s also worth noting that some gambling sites integrate innovative features, including live chat support and detailed history tracking, to create a more transparent and supportive environment.

Common Pitfalls and How to Avoid Them
One of the biggest mistakes players make is rushing into a gambling website without proper research. It’s tempting to sign up where bonuses look biggest or games appear flashiest, but these choices can sometimes mask less trustworthy conditions. Terms and conditions might hide wagering requirements that make it difficult to withdraw winnings, or payment methods might carry unexpected fees.
Here’s a quick list of practical tips to stay on the right path:
- Check the licensing and regulatory information prominently displayed on the site.
- Review payment options and withdrawal times before committing.
- Look up RTP percentages for favorite games to gauge their fairness.
- Read user reviews to get a sense of the site’s reputation.
- Understand the bonus conditions thoroughly to avoid surprises.

How Technology Shapes Your Gambling Experience
Technological advancements have transformed gambling websites significantly over the past decade. The rise of mobile gaming means players can enjoy titles like Play’n GO’s Book of Dead on smartphones anytime, anywhere. Meanwhile, live streaming technologies enable real-time interaction with professional dealers, adding an authentic casino feel without leaving home.
Security protocols have also evolved, with sites implementing SSL encryption to protect sensitive data. Some platforms incorporate identity verification tools such as BankID to ensure that accounts are secure and comply with anti-fraud regulations. These measures are essential not just for player protection but also for upholding the integrity of the games.

Keeping Your Wits About You: Responsible Gambling
Gambling should be approached as a form of entertainment rather than a way to make money. It’s important to set limits and recognize when the experience stops being fun and starts becoming problematic. Many platforms now offer tools such as de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and reality checks to help players maintain control. Recognizing the signs of trouble early can prevent significant harm.
